How To Infuse Store Bought Gummies With Tincture: The Complete Technical Guide
Infusing store-bought gummies with a cannabis or herbal tincture requires precise control over solvent evaporation and surface-to-volume absorption rates to prevent dissolution and achieve accurate dosing. By utilizing high-proof alcohol-based extracts and lecithin as a binding agent, home operators can bypass the complex confectionery cooking process while maintaining uniform potency.
Pre-Operation & Equipment Checklist
Successfully applying a liquid extract to a pre-manufactured gelatin or pectin matrix requires an understanding of structural integrity and absorption thermodynamics. Store-bought gummies are already fully set, meaning they possess a moisture-sealed exterior skin that rejects external liquids unless properly prepped or bound.
- Essential Gear and Tools: High-precision digital milligram scale (0.01g resolution), food-grade glass or silicone dropper pipettes, wide glass evaporating dish or silicone baking mat, culinary tweezers, and a food-grade spray bottle for atomizing liquids.
- Materials and Ingredients: Store-bought gelatin or pectin gummies (firm textures work best), food-grade cannabis or herbal alcohol-based tincture (high-potency, low-volume preferred), and liquid sunflower or soy lecithin (acting as an emulsifier and bioavailability enhancer).
- Prerequisite Standards and Benchmarks: Ambient room temperature must be maintained between 68°F and 72°F with relative humidity below 50 percent to prevent moisture reabsorption during drying. Estimated duration: 30 to 45 minutes of active preparation, followed by 12 to 24 hours of curing time. Estimated equipment budget: $20 to $50.
Step-by-Step Infusion Workflow
Step 1: Calculating Potency and Dosage Ratios
Determine the total milligram content of your tincture and divide it by the total number of store-bought gummies you intend to infuse to find the target dose per piece. Measure out a uniform batch of gummies, ensuring they are free of excessive exterior cornstarch or sanding sugar dust, which can act as a physical barrier against liquid absorption.
Pro-Tip: Always select alcohol-based tinctures over oil-based options when working with store-bought gummies. Alcohol evaporates cleanly, leaving the active compounds integrated into the surface matrix without leaving an unpalatable greasy residue.
Step 2: Preparing the Emulsified Infusion Solution
Create an even suspension by combining your calculated volume of tincture with a minimal amount of liquid lecithin (approximately one drop per ten gummies). The lecithin acts as a surfactant, breaking down surface tension and allowing the active botanical extract to bind evenly across the exterior and semi-porous outer layer of the candy rather than pooling unevenly.
Warning: Never use excessive heat to speed up this process. Applying temperatures above 140°F (60°C) will degrade vulnerable active compounds and melt the structural integrity of the store-bought gummies.
Step 3: Applying the Tincture via Atomization or Dropper
Arrange your gummies in a single layer on a non-stick silicone baking mat, ensuring they do not touch one another. Using a calibrated glass dropper or a fine-mist food-grade spray bottle, apply the tincture-lecithin solution evenly across the surfaces of the gummies.
Pro-Tip: If using a dropper, apply half the calculated dose to the top of the gummies, allow it to penetrate for ten minutes, flip them using culinary tweezers, and apply the remaining half to the underside for maximum distribution balance.
Step 4: Curing and Solvent Evaporation
Allow the freshly treated gummies to rest undisturbed in a well-ventilated, dark environment for a minimum of 12 to 24 hours. This mandatory drying phase ensures that all residual ethanol or extraction solvents completely evaporate off the surface, leaving behind only the concentrated active constituents bonded by the lecithin.

Common Site Failures and Field Fixes
- Root Cause: Gummies dissolve into a sticky, misshapen paste during the application process.
- Actionable Fix: You likely used a water-based tincture or applied too much liquid at once. Switch exclusively to high-potency, high-proof alcohol tinctures (150 proof or higher) and apply the liquid in micro-droplets or fine mists rather than pooling.
- Root Cause: Active compounds flake off or rub off after the gummies have seemingly dried.
- Actionable Fix: The formulation lacked a binding agent. Incorporate food-grade liquid lecithin into your tincture blend before application to anchor the active botanical constituents directly to the gummy's outer polymer chain.
- Root Cause: Inconsistent dosing effects from one gummy to the next within the same batch.
- Actionable Fix: The gummies were crowded together during application, causing liquid to transfer unevenly via physical contact. Maintain at least one inch of physical spacing between individual pieces on your silicone drying mat.
Frequently Asked Questions
Can I use oil-based tinctures on store-bought gummies?
Oil-based tinctures (such as MCT or olive oil infusions) are strongly discouraged for store-bought gummies because the candy's outer texture is water-soluble and non-porous to lipids. The oil will fail to absorb, remaining as an unpalatable, slippery film that easily rubs off and results in highly inaccurate dosing.
Why is high-proof alcohol required for this method?
High-proof alcohol (like 190-proof food-grade ethanol) evaporates rapidly at room temperature without requiring heat. This rapid evaporation rate allows the tincture to penetrate the outer molecular layer of the gummy before the structural integrity of the gelatin or pectin is compromised by excess moisture.
How long do infused store-bought gummies last?
The shelf life depends primarily on the moisture content retained from the original packaging and the environment. Once the alcohol has completely evaporated and the gummies are fully dry, store them in an airtight glass container in a cool, dark place to maintain stability for up to two to three months.
Will this method work with sour-sanded gummies?
Sour-sanded gummies coated in citric acid and sugar will absorb tincture poorly unless the exterior coating is first rinsed or brushed away. The heavy layer of dry crystals acts as a sponge that absorbs your expensive extract unevenly, leading to erratic potency distribution.
